E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
manacher算法应用
hihocoder#1589 : 回文子串的数量(
manacher
)
时间限制:10000ms单点时限:1000ms内存限制:256MB描述给定一个字符串S,请统计S的所有|S|*(|S|+1)/2个子串中(首尾位置不同就算作不同的子串),有多少个是回文字符串?输入一个只包含小写字母的字符串S。对于30%的数据,S长度不超过100。对于60%的数据,S长度不超过1000。对于100%的数据,S长度不超过800000。输出回文子串的数量样例输入abbab样例输出8思路
Mitsuha_
·
2020-09-15 21:39
字符串-Manacher
回文字符串--
manacher
算法
回文字符串--
manacher
算法回文串定义:“回文串”是一个正读和反读都一样的字符串,比如“level”或者“noon”等等就是回文串。回文子串,顾名思义,即字符串中满足回文性质的子串。
龙腾四海365
·
2020-09-15 21:58
算法知识点
继电反馈自整定算法
PID
算法应用
中最为重要的是参数的整定。通常,参数的整定高度依赖工程技术人员的经验,而且实际系统又是千差万别,存在着诸如非线性、时变、大滞后等因素。
Shijia Yin
·
2020-09-15 18:46
卫星网络中使用TCP协议的劣势
但这些
算法应用
的前提是网络发生拥塞造成丢包,然而在误码率相对较高的卫星通信系统中,部分丢包是由误码造成的,tcp协议对此不能区分,从而造成TCP传输性能的恶化。
Crazy_Tortoise
·
2020-09-15 17:54
TCP/IP
5. Longest Palindromic Substring(最长回文串)
两个思路:一个O(N^2),一个O(N)时间复杂度思路一:n^2的是通过从每个节点往两边扩思路二:
manacher
算法,通过先扩展字符串用#隔开,然后遍历的过程中记录一个当前最大右边界,以当前i为中心的回文串长度
汝之宿命
·
2020-09-15 05:33
leetcode
THUPC2018 string (
Manacher
)
题目链接:传送门题意描述:我们定义翻转的操作:把一个串以最后一个字符作对称轴进行翻转复制。形式化地描述就是,如果他翻转的串为RR,那么他会将前|R|−1|R|−1个字符倒序排列后,插入到串的最后。举例而言,串'abcd'进行翻转操作后,将得到'abcdcba';串'qw'连续进行22次翻转操作后,将得到'qwqwq';串'z'无论进行多少次翻转操作,都不会被改变。现在,我们知道了一个串翻转后的的前
Lambert-O
·
2020-09-14 21:21
manacher
算法模板
chars[maxn=0;--i){s[i+i+2]=s[i];s[i+i+1]='#';}s[0]='*';for(inti=2;ii)p[i]=min(p[2*id-i],p[id]+id-i);elsep[i]=1;while(s[i-p[i]]==s[i+p[i]])++p[i];if(id+p[id]<i+p[i])id=i;if(i%2==0)Len[i/2-1]=p[i]-1;}}
My_ACM_Dream
·
2020-09-14 18:01
字符串
机器学习入门(二):模型的获取和改进
获取模型的过程在前面讲述三要素时我们已经讲过:数据+算法=>模型获得模型的过程——训练——是将
算法应用
到数据上进行运算的过程。笼统而言,为了构
米饭超人
·
2020-09-14 12:03
图论总结
我觉得图论就是分为
算法应用
和建图技巧。
Zbw_OIer
·
2020-09-14 06:06
图论
java实现贪心算法
算法应用
背景假设存在如下表的需要付费的广播台,以及广播台信号可以覆盖的地区。
冬雪是你
·
2020-09-14 00:42
数据结构与算法(java实现)
java
数据结构
算法
小白数学建模模型入门(二)
数学建模模型入门(二)1.图论模型-Dijkstra
算法应用
于求初始点到其他所有顶点的最短路径。本质是一种标号法,给赋权图的每一个顶点记一个数,称为顶点的标号。(临时标号,称T标号。
阿群今天学习了吗
·
2020-09-13 23:59
数学建模笔记
2020年SDUTACM暑假集训阶段总结
暑假集训阶段总结9#501计科1902杜广优一、学习内容–暑假新学了哪些专题,每个专题刷了多少题(1)背包进阶6(2)字典树3(3)线段树3(4)线段树扫描线1(5)数论基础5(6)KMP5(7)exKMP1(8)
manacher
1
SDUT_you
·
2020-09-13 20:54
笔记
计算机排序算法艺术
排序算法是最为重要的
算法应用
之一。
liwenjia1981
·
2020-09-13 19:32
计算机算法艺术
数据结构 串模式匹配 KMP算法
【数据结构】串KMP算法实现KMP
算法应用
于串的模式匹配中普通模式匹配算法在进行匹配时需要频繁对主串指针进行回溯,KMP算法通过将模式向右滑动一段距离的方式避免了主串的回溯,同时降低了算法复杂度,由原来的
欢乐佛
·
2020-09-13 18:55
数据结构严蔚敏
Hadoop应用开发实战案例视频教程
课程目录│├─作业│作业.rar11KB│├─第10周聚类
算法应用
,分析优质客户(Map-Reduce,Mahout)│hadoop_dev_10.rar114.26MB│Hadoop_dev_10.zip1.79MB
weixin_46240970
·
2020-09-13 13:45
manacher
算法
manacher
算法:定义数组p[i]表示以i为中心的(包含i这个字符)回文串半径长将字符串s从前扫到后for(inti=0;imaxlen,则初始化p[i+k]=1;//本身是回文串然后p[i+k]左右延伸
hpu刘
·
2020-09-13 13:40
PAT C 语言入门题目-7-64 最长对称子串 (25 分)四种方法求解(暴力枚举+动态规划+中心扩展+
manacher
算法(马拉车))
7-64最长对称子串(25分)对给定的字符串,本题要求你输出最长对称子串的长度。例如,给定IsPAT&TAPsymmetric?,最长对称子串为sPAT&TAPs,于是你应该输出11。输入格式:输入在一行中给出长度不超过1000的非空字符串。输出格式:在一行中输出最长对称子串的长度。输入样例:IsPAT&TAPsymmetric?输出样例:11四种方法链接以下仅动态规划法:令dp[i][j]表示S
Scarlett·S
·
2020-09-13 12:16
C
动态规划
最长对称子串
Manacher
算法
L2-008.最长对称子串时间限制100ms内存限制65536kB代码长度限制8000B判题程序Standard作者陈越对给定的字符串,本题要求你输出最长对称子串的长度。例如,给定"IsPAT&TAPsymmetric?",最长对称子串为"sPAT&TAPs",于是你应该输出11。输入格式:输入在一行中给出长度不超过1000的非空字符串。输出格式:在一行中输出最长对称子串的长度。输入样例:IsPA
i逆天耗子丶
·
2020-09-13 12:04
PTA基础编程题目集
数据结构
-
字符串
竞赛常用算法题目解析
序列比对(十六)——Baum-Welch算法估算HMM参数
Baum-Welch
算法应用
于HMM的效果前文《序列比对(15)EM算法以及Baum-Welch算法的推导》介绍了EM算法和Baum-Welch算法的推导过程。
生信了(公众号同名)
·
2020-09-13 11:19
#
序列算法
第5题 查找字符串中的最长回文字符串---
Manacher
算法
转载:https://www.felix021.com/blog/read.php?2040首先用一个非常巧妙的方式,将所有可能的奇数/偶数长度的回文子串都转换成了奇数长度:在每个字符的两边都插入一个特殊的符号。比如abba变成#a#b#b#a#,aba变成#a#b#a#。为了进一步减少编码的复杂度,可以在字符串的开始和结尾加入另一个特殊字符这样就不用特殊处理越界问题,比如%#a#b#a#@;(如
weixin_30752377
·
2020-09-13 11:57
php
Manacher
算法获取最长回文子串长度及其扩展应用
这一篇介绍一下获取字符串最长回文子串长度的
Manacher
算法,以及
Manacher
算法的扩展应用先介绍一个获取字符串最长回文子串长度的暴力解法时间复杂度:O(N^2)/*@Author:lwl2020
LWL20201104
·
2020-09-13 07:56
算法与数据结构
字符串
算法
2019年5月做题记录
洛谷P2032(单调队列)洛谷P1638(尺取法)洛谷P1714(尺取法)洛谷P2947(单调队列)洛谷P1886(单调队列)洛谷P1901(单调队列)洛谷P3805(
Manacher
算法)洛谷P1217
FairyTail0423
·
2020-09-13 04:59
京东购物在微信等场景下的
算法应用
实践
本文根据京东微信手Q业务部马老师在京东\u0026amp;DataFunTalk算法架构系列活动中所分享的《京东购物在微信等场景下的
算法应用
实践》编辑整理而成,在未改变原意的基础上稍做修改。
世上我最好2
·
2020-09-13 01:26
网络安全-哈希算法和数字签名
1.单向散列算法单向散列算法也称为哈希算法,它是一种不可逆的单向数学函数,把哈希
算法应用
于任意长度的一块数据,可以将它映射为一段数据唯一的、不可逆的、定长的、极其紧凑的字符串,这个字符串便称为散列值、哈希值或消息摘要
公众号:海若Hero
·
2020-09-13 00:08
【技术分享】京东电商广告和推荐的机器学习系统实践
讲师简介▲包勇军2014年4月加入京东数字营销业务部,参与组建并带领模型团队,自主研发出京东大规模机器学习平台,同时还负责京东电商广告深度学习
算法应用
和优化的工作。
凌风探梅
·
2020-09-13 00:50
推荐系统
基于UNet网络实现的人像分割 | 附数据集
点击上方“AI算法与图像处理”,选择加"星标"或“置顶”重磅干货,第一时间送达以后我会在公众号分享一些关于算法的应用(美颜相关的),工作之后,发现更重要的能力如何理解业务并将
算法应用
其中创造价值,以及如何落地
flyfor2013
·
2020-09-12 19:04
加密
算法应用
C# code
1。MD5Message-Digest5算法,这是一种单向加密方法。无法通过所得到的密文推导出明文来。所得到密文有固定长度。.Net的实现中,长度为128位,用途:对某不限长度的信息内容所产生的密文可以作为唯一标记符号,用作数字签字。若信息内容发生变化,则其产生的密文与旧密文必然不相等。可以验证文件在传输过程中是否发生改变。保护用户的密码,将密文保存到数据库,后台工作人员也不能看到用户的密码。2。
abwhyrb767234
·
2020-09-12 19:37
数据库
拓扑排序(TopologicalSort)算法
拓扑排序
算法应用
:有些事情做都需要按照流程的去做,比如你准备约你小女友去影院看速度与激情7大片,首先你想的是我怎么到达影院,然后达到影院,你可以先买票,或者等小女友来了一起买票,然后一起进电影大厅...
weixin_30242907
·
2020-09-12 12:04
数据结构与算法
A fast approach to global alignment of protein-protein interaction networks
常用的全局比对技术(如IsoRank)依赖于两步过程:第一步是基于迭代扩散的方法,用于将相似性分数分配给所有可能的节点对(匹配);第二步将最大权重二部匹配
算法应用
于该相似性分数矩阵,以识别同源节点对。
Toxic_皮
·
2020-09-12 11:08
复杂网络
算法应用
-水仙花数
水仙花数publicstaticvoidmain(String[]args){inta=0,b=0,c=0;System.out.println("水仙花数是:");for(inti=100;i<1000;i++)//遍历所有3位数{a=i/100;//获取3位数中百位的数b=i%100/10;//获取3位数中十位的数c=i%100%10;//获取3位数中个位的数a=a*a*a;//计算第一位数的
zhangll98
·
2020-09-12 08:33
manacher
(马拉车)算法简单讲解
介绍:
manacher
是一种用来求字符串子串中最长回文长度,时间复杂度可以达到O(n)O(n)O(n)级别。下面先介绍暴力求解法。
glancelike
·
2020-09-12 06:10
算法
字符串
字符串
算法
遗传
算法应用
案例
>案例一.无约束目标函数最大值遗传算法求解策略求解问题%主程序:用遗传算法求解y=200*exp(-0.05*x).*sin(x)在[-2,2]上的最大值clc;clearall;closeall;globalBitLengthglobalboundsbeginglobalboundsendbounds=[-22];%一维自变量的取值范围precision=0.0001;%运算精度boundsbe
他们都叫我神奇
·
2020-09-12 05:46
数学
建模
匈牙利算法求二分图的最优匹配(java)
算法应用
场景:农夫约翰上个星期刚刚建好了他的新牛棚,他使用了最新的挤奶技术。不幸的是,由于工程问题,每个牛栏都不一样。
JavaMan_chen
·
2020-09-12 05:04
算法
manacher
-马拉车算法
manacher
是一种优秀的,可以在O(n)时间复杂度内求最长回文子串个数的算法,又叫做“马拉车”先膜一下大佬Orz,我是看ZigZagK学长的博客看懂的,神奇的传送门。
蒟蒻赵文川
·
2020-09-12 05:03
字符串
string
字符串
2019年人工智能
算法应用
场景详解
今天人工智能的发展可以说是突飞猛进,那么人工智能的算法有哪些应用场景呢,我对人工智能很感兴趣,已经研究多年,这里来跟大家总结一下,我一直对机器学习感兴趣,没有时间去研究它。今天只是周末。我有时间去各种技术论坛,看一篇关于机器学习的好文章。我会在这里和你分享。机器学习无疑是数据分析领域的一个热门话题。许多人在日常工作中或多或少使用机器学习算法。在这里,信息技术经理网络总结了常见的机器学习算法,供您在
aifans_bert
·
2020-09-11 21:04
人工智能
人工智能
算法
左程云直播8.7-互为变形词、旋转词、
manacher
算法
1互为变形词-str1中的词重新组合成为str2(种类+个数)【题目三】给定两个字符串str1和str2,如果str1和str2中出现的字符种类一样且每种字符出现的次数也一样,那么str1与str2互为变形词。请实现函数判断两个字符串是否互为变形词。【举例】str1=”123”,str2=”231”,返回true。str1=”123”,str2=”2331”,返回false。分析:桶排序。先判断两
blackboydec
·
2020-09-11 06:08
数据结构和算法
【最长回文子串】HDU3068最长回文【
Manacher
算法】
一张图领悟
Manacher
算法,计算字符串最长回文子串题目链接:http://acm.hdu.edu.cn/showproblem.php?
wlxsq
·
2020-09-11 05:04
字符串
机器学习
算法应用
场景实例六十则
本文整理了60个机器学习
算法应用
场景实例,含分类
算法应用
场景20个、回归
算法应用
场景20个、聚类
算法应用
场景10个以及关联规则应用场景10个。
eddieHoo
·
2020-09-11 04:52
机器学习
Manacher
's Algorithm 马拉车算法,线性查找一个字符串的最长回文子串
学习自这篇博客,博主写得非常好,算法原理请看这篇博客,而代码实现下面的更明了intp[100000];stringsolve(strings){stringt="$#";for(inti=0;ii?min(p[2*id-i],mx-i):1;while(t[i+p[i]]==t[i-p[i]])++p[i];if(mx#include#include#include#include#include
loading。。。
·
2020-09-11 03:34
字符串
(一)实际项目中树形数据结构与递归
算法应用
前言:在大部分个项目中几乎都涉及到菜单的展示,在这里普遍用到了树形数据结构和递归算法:1.举例:建表:(1)模拟效果图:(2)代码片段:2.数据库中运用sql进行树形查询:(1)mysql比较麻烦,稍后展开论述(2)oracle树形查询:使用Startwith...ConnectBy子句递归查询,一般用于一个表维护树形结构的应用。创建示例表:CREATETABLETBL_TEST(IDNUMBER
zzw222222
·
2020-09-10 22:16
java应用软件实践
软件开发中常用的算法
机器学习方法篇(10)------随机森林
导语前面介绍了决策树
算法应用
之一的GBDT模型,本节讲讲决策树另一个比较火的应用模型,随机森林。与GBDT模型相比,同样属于集成学习,随机森林模型的原理更为直观简洁,性能也同样十分强悍。
对半独白
·
2020-09-10 12:00
机器学习方法系列
为什么说卷积神经网络,是深度学习
算法应用
最成功的领域之一?
点击蓝色“AI专栏”关注我哟重磅干货,第一时间送达01PART深度学习与卷积神经网络(CNN)小白必须学习CNN经典论文代码的理由CNN真正的爆发阶段是2012年AlexNet取得ImageNet比赛的分类任务的冠军,从此以后,深度学习便也成为了一个热门的领域,所以说,如果小白要入门深度学习,就必须要先把经典的CNN认真过一篇,才能真正地掌握深度学习的基本知识,也才可以方便为后续学习其他网络打下坚
AI专栏
·
2020-09-01 23:43
神经网络
卷积
图像识别
卷积神经网络
计算机视觉
智能优化
算法应用
:基于GWO优化的指数熵图像多阈值分割 - 附代码
智能优化
算法应用
:基于GWO优化的指数熵图像多阈值分割文章目录智能优化
算法应用
:基于GWO优化的指数熵图像多阈值分割1.前言2.指数熵阈值分割原理3.基于灰狼优化(GWO)的多阈值分割4.算法结果:5.
Jack旭
·
2020-08-27 16:51
智能优化算法应用
图像分割
算法
计算机视觉
人工智能
【NLP】文本标注工具推荐
随着NLP
算法应用
发展,数据训练需要
leejninging
·
2020-08-26 16:29
最短路算法之Dijkstra算法通俗解释
Dijkstra算法说明:求解从起点到任意点的最短距离,注意该
算法应用
于没有负边的图。来,看图。
weixin_30693683
·
2020-08-26 15:09
路径规划求最短路径——Dijkstra算法一步一步讲清楚(附代码/可执行)
1.最短路径&&Dijkstra算法——引入(1)定义:从图中的某个顶点出发到达另外一个顶点的所经过的边的权重和最小的一条路径,称为最短路径;(2)
算法应用
:移动机器人在路径规划中,得知起始点和终止点,
大壮159
·
2020-08-26 13:50
路径规划最短路径
最大流
文章目录定义流网络((flownetwork))多源多汇剩余网络(residualnetwork)增广路径((AugmentingPath)截(Cut)Ford-Fulkerson算法Edmonds-Karp
算法应用
城志
·
2020-08-26 13:41
算法和数据结构
70道面试常见算法题
注意边界回文判断:判断字符串是否为回文串双指针从两头往中间扫描判断链表是否回文(1)快慢指针找中点(2)翻转后半部分(3)遍历比较两段链表判断栈是否回文出栈后再入栈,与原字符串比较是否完全相同最长回文子串
manacher
GavinGreenson
·
2020-08-26 11:58
CS考研复试
使用TF-IDF对Tweets做summarization
本文尝试将经典的TF-IDF
算法应用
到tweets上提取原文中最有代表性的句子做automaticsummarizatio
mikelkl
·
2020-08-26 07:17
AI
自然语言处理
python hashlib 哈希算法
写在篇前哈希加密
算法应用
非常广泛,包括数字签名,身份验证,操作检测,指纹,校验和(消息完整性检查),哈希表,密码存储等。
jeffery0207
·
2020-08-26 07:03
Python
上一页
20
21
22
23
24
25
26
27
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他